
On this week's episode of 'Jaefriends', WINNER members Kang Seung Yoon and Kim Jin Woo appeared as guests and discussed the trainee culture at YG Entertainment.
On this day, host Jaejoong asked the two members of WINNER, "I heard that YG strongly encourages the trainees to adopt a hip-hop mentality early on. Is that true?"
The two answered, "That's definitely true. You can tell just by looking at the way YG trainees dress."
Jaejoong further observed, "See, typically, entertainment companies won't let trainees dress up or wear fancy accessories. But at YG, the trainees are free to dress up however they want."





Hearing this, Kim Jin Woo wondered, "Do other companies actually regulate that stuff?", to which Jaejoong replied, "So usually, the company will say to a trainee who dresses up too much, 'Do you think this is the time for you to be dressing yourself up? You need to be working on nurturing yourself as a person on the inside, not the outside.'"
However, at YG, Kang Seung Yoon revealed, "If we didn't dress up, the company would say, 'Why do you look so unstylish?' It made us want to study fashion more and try stuff out, and we would always go out shopping to make ourselves look better."
To this, Jaejoong said, "In the training system I'm used to, they look at the trainee completely raw. When that trainee is deemed to have potential for stardom, then the company starts trying things out, like different clothes and accessories."
